Title
Livingston, Miles; Hall, Byron; Jackson, Timothy; Southwood, Cody; Harris, John; and Lieutenant Ward, nominees for the 2017 Alabama Legislative Medal of Honor for Law Enforcement, commended
Summary

A ceremonial House Joint Resolution recognizing and commending Decatur Police Department officers as nominees for the 2017 Alabama Legislative Medal of Honor for Law Enforcement.

What This Bill Does

It recognizes Officers Miles Livingston, Byron Hall, Timothy Jackson, and Cody Southwood, Sergeant John Harris, and Lieutenant Ward as nominees for the 2017 Medal of Honor for Law Enforcement. It describes their actions during an early-morning apartment fire and honors their courage and quick response. It directs that each officer receive a copy of the resolution as evidence of the legislature's admiration, and it does not change any laws or provide funding.
